Gaity Ahmad: From Strategy to Surgery Closing the Women’s Health Gap

Gaity Ahmad, Member of Guideline Committee RCOG at Royal College of Obstetricians and Gynaecologists, shared a post on LinkedIn:

“The new Women’s Health Strategy is a promise for the future. But women in Greater Manchester are in a crisis today.

Policy is a start.

But the data is staggering:

  • The 65-Week Failure: Nationally, ~7,500 patients still wait over 15 months for surgery.
  • The Gender Gap: Gynaecology patients represent a huge, unfair share of these long waits.
  • The Greater Manchester Crisis: 40,000 women are currently waiting for care in our region.
  • Surgical Backlog: 10,000 of those women are waiting specifically for an operation.
  • The Diagnostic Delay: Many of these women have already waited 9+ years for an Endometriosis diagnosis.

We cannot ‘tackle medical misogyny’ while women wait over a year and a quarter for basic surgical care.

A hidden data- women wait more than 10 years for diagnosis and treatment of a chronic disease endometriosis which affects 1 in 10 of women.

A 10-year strategy is a welcome step. But the 10,000 women in GM waiting for surgery need a ‘right now’ solution.

Policy is a promise. Patients need procedures, access to specialists and theatres.

Let’s work together to address health inequality.”
